{"product_id":"national-instruments-usrp-2942","title":"National Instruments USRP-2942","description":"\u003cp\u003eThe National Instruments USRP-2942 is an advanced Software Defined Radio (SDR) device designed for robust wireless communications research and development. With part numbers 783147-01 and 783924-01, this device is equipped with a Kintex-7 410T FPGA that facilitates efficient processing and reconfigurability. The USRP-2942 offers two input and two output channels, supporting a dynamic RF frequency range from 400 MHz to 4.4 GHz, allowing for versatility in various applications including MIMO, LTE, beamforming, and cognitive radio.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eThe device connects via Ethernet and MXIe bus connectors, and it operates on Windows-compatible environments with the recommended use of the NI instrument driver and LabVIEW application tools for installation and programming. A maximum bandwidth of 40 MHz is achievable, and the transmitter and receiver gain can be adjusted in steps of 0.5 decibels. The power requirements include a DC input voltage ranging from 9 V to 16 V, with a maximum current draw of 7.5 A. The USRP-2942 measures 10.5 inches by 1.6 inches by 8.6 inches and weighs 3.50 pounds. For detailed guidance, both a user manual and a maintenance manual are available for download.
